Land fires in Indonesia occur on dry land as well as on peatlands. Fires on peatlands are more dangerous and more challenging to tackle than fires on non-peatlands, and the consequences of peatland fires that occur are very detrimental to communities. One of the solutions offered in assessing forest and peatland fires is remote sensing technology. Satellite images obtained from remote sensing technology are usually classified for further analysis. The main objective of this study is to develop a classification model using the Probabilistic Neural Network (PNN) to classify areas in peatlands before, during, and after burning on Landsat 7 ETM+ satellite imagery. Furthermore, the model is used to obtain the trajectory pattern of the burned area using the DBScan algorithm. The research area is Ogan Komering Ilir Regency; South Sumatra Province Landsat 7 ETM+ images were taken from January 2015 – December 2015.

Autoimmune diseases are diseases that attack the human immune system. Autoimmunity is a disorder of the immune system due to the failure of the body's defenses to stabilize conditions so that the immune system attacks a healthy body which is considered a foreign object that must be destroyed. Helping the public in the early detection of autoimmune diseases by using an expert system that is expected to detect autoimmune diseases early in Tanjungbalai Hospital so that they can provide early information about autoimmune diseases and appropriate and informative subsequent actions to the community. In this study, an expert system was built using the web-based Dempster-Shafer method based on the value of expert trust in the symptoms felt by the patient. There were 7 types of autoimmune diseases studied: ITP, SLE, Type 1 DM, Graves Disease, RA (Rheumatoid Arthritis), Autoimmune Hepatitis, and Hashimoto's Thyroiditis. This study resulted in ITP with an accuracy rate of 98%, SLE with an accuracy rate of 96%, Diabetes Mellitus Type 1 with an accuracy rate of 96%, Graves Disease with an accuracy rate of 93%, RA (Rheumatoid Arthritis) with an accuracy rate of 99%, Autoimmune Hepatitis with a 94% accuracy, and Hashimoto's thyroiditis with 99% accuracy.

Abstract When compared with other types of cancer, most of the population with cancer die from lung cancer.A person needs to do a screening test through X-rays, CT scans, and MRI to detect the disease. However, before carrying out the process, the doctor will ordinarily investigate a medical history and physical examination first to study the symptoms and possible risk factors for lung cancer. The lung cancer data set has a class imbalance that affects the performance of the random forest algorithm in predicting the risk of lung cancer. This study aims to employ the SMOTE technique to the random forest algorithm to increase accuracy in predicting lung cancer risk. In this research, data processing and analysis use the Python programming language. The test results show an accuracy value of 88% with an AUC value of 0.93. When employing the random forest method to forecast lung cancer risk, the SMOTE technique is useful in dealing with class imbalances in the data set.
